xlxo Posted June 1, 2016 #3 Share Posted June 1, 2016 When I was on the Wonder in Aug 2013..... I was happy where the Wonder was and would NOT spend $200 to get 1/8 mile closer through the ice and wildlife. The small boat is new this year. So I'm very curious to see whether the Wonder is shortening the 31 mile journey up Tracy Arm to meet up with Sawyer. Right now cruise ships are limited to 17 miles up Tracy Arm like due to ice congestion. We can all study the distance up the arm with marinetraffic.com nightly. The Disney Wonder visits Tracy Arm on Wednesday, so you can look at the past track on Wednesday nights to see how close it gets to Sawyer. As the ice clear in the coming months. We can see whether the Wonder is able to meet up with Sawyer and whether the small boat is worth getting 1/8th mile closer.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
